Assistant Vice President of Credit Union Operations


Job Details

The Assistant Vice President of Credit Union Operations is responsible for ensuring the member experience and delivery of services to the members through the leadership of the retail team, which includes branches and contact center teams, to achieve organizational service and sales goals. This position supports the VP of Operations in driving the implementation of our sales and service program, the growth of our products and services, coaching and developing our retail team associates; along with ensuring the retail areas comply with all procedures, policies, and regulations.

Responsibilities:

  • Responsible for directing job assignments, monitoring staff performance, coaching, training, and assuring compliance with regulatory requirements and standards of conduct.
  • Assist the VP of Operations in monitoring all branch and contact center activities to ensure compliance with established credit union policies and procedures. Monitors and coaches, the Credit Union's sales and service behaviors, ensuring that the member experience provided is consistent with credit union standards.
  • Supports the VP of Operations in directing, developing, motivating, and managing the branch and contact center associates. Administers performance evaluations and recommends appropriate personnel actions. Maintains consistent communications with the VP of Operations and other Business Partners as appropriate.
  • Ensure retail associates are well-trained in all phases of their respective jobs. Trains associates by modeling our sales and service standards designed to establish strong member relationships.
  • Consult members to present products and services that align with members' needs and position the credit union to become the (PFI) Preferred Financial Institution for the member. Process and close loan applications to include Consumer Auto, Visa, and Home Equity applications. Work, monitor, and coach associates on outbound calling campaigns to assist in meeting sales goals.
  • Monitors and coaches on quality assurance of new accounts and loans.
  • Collaborates and assists with retail supervisors in streamlining operations to ease associates' and new member efforts.
  • Works closely with Branch Supervisors to ensure optimal staffing and scheduling to ensure member service is meeting standards.
  • Proactively seek solutions that benefit members and the credit union while exhibiting sound and accurate judgment.
  • Other duties as assigned.


Qualifications:
  • Associate or Bachelor's degree in business or related field.
  • Minimum 5 years of retail banking experience in progressively responsible roles.
  • Experience leading multiple teams.
  • Experience collaborating across teams/departments.
  • Ability to problem solve quickly.
  • Excellent communication and decision-making skills to effectively resolve member and associate issues.
  • Time-management skills, balancing team, and individual responsibilities.
  • In-depth knowledge of retail operations, which includes knowledge of lending practices.
  • Strong Microsoft Office skills.
